VOICE OF IRELAND 2013 winner Keith Hanley was on the Late Late Show last night.

He’s a lovely lad from Cork, and he performed his upcoming debut single – a cover of Blue by Eiffel 65.

It was a slowed-down, emotional version of the song. You can see it on the RTÉ Player here, or here’s a taster of Keith Hanley’s version:
